Long considered a mysterious monster from the deep, the great white shark is actually from the shallow — and no longer all that mysterious. That’s according to a group of pioneering researchers who, using sophisticated electronic tracking equipment, have compiled the first-ever detailed swim-maps of several great white sharks in Mossel Bay.
